Аннотация
The possibility of increasing the reversible deformation to 1.9% of corrosion-resistant steels 0.30C–14Cr–15Mn–4Si–3Ni–1V and 0.30C–14Cr–15Mn–4Si–3Ni,which exhibits the shape-memory effect has been shown. The increase has been achieved at the expense of a decrease in the chromium and carbon contents in an austenite matrix, which results from the decrease in the quenching temperature and increase in the time of destabilizing carbide aging.
